The National Symphony Orchestra (NSO) has announced its programming and guest artists for its performances at Wolf Trap, America’s National Park for the Performing Arts in Vienna, Virginia, July 7-August 6. Emil de Cou serves as Wolf Trap Festival Conductor.

Jan Horvath, Debbie Gravitte, and Christiane Noll will join the NSO for Three Broadway Divas (July 9), featuring numbers from Gypsy, The Music Man, A Chorus Line, Wicked and more.

The Wolf Trap Opera Company will perform Stephen Sondheim’s Sweeney Todd (July 22), with James Moore conducting the NSO.

Marvin Hamlisch and Brian Stokes Mitchell with Stephanie J.Block (July 29) will feature the celebrated composer and the stage stars performing an evening of Broadway magic.

Steven Reineke will conduct the NSO in Disney in Concert: Magical Music from the Movies (August 4), featuring video clips and songs from The Little Mermaid, Aladdin, Pirates of the Caribbean, and The Lion King.

Additional programming will include Tcheers for Tchaikovsky (July 7); PLAY! A Video Game Symphony (July 8); The 5 Browns (July 28); Casablanca (July 30); Tan Dun: Martial Arts Trilogy (August 5); and Arlo Guthrie and Time for Three (August 6).
